Necrological Service Program Process: A Detailed Analysis

The necrological service program process typically follows a structured series of steps. It generally starts with the initial contact with the bereaved. This is then the arrangement conference, where elements such as the timing, location, services, and music are decided. Next, obituary writing is written and released to multiple outlets. Following this, preparation of the body occurs, often with a viewing or wake. The main memorial itself then takes effect, inclusive of prayers, remembrances, and music. Finally, the ritual finishes with the burial or scattering of the cremated remains.
